Introduction to Filter Dryer Equipment Market
Filter dryer equipment stands at the nexus of critical industrial processes, offering a robust solution for the removal of moisture and contaminants from compressed air systems, gas streams, and process media. As global manufacturers pursue greater operational efficiency, product quality, and regulatory compliance, the role of filter dryers has grown substantially. These devices safeguard equipment longevity, reduce maintenance costs, and ensure the purity standards required in pharmaceutical production, food and beverage processing, petrochemical operations, and chemical manufacturing. Recent developments in materials science, digital integration, and energy optimization have further elevated performance benchmarks, prompting decision-makers to reevaluate existing installations and upgrade legacy systems. Transformative Shifts in the Filter Dryer Landscape
Industrial stakeholders across multiple sectors are navigating a period of rapid transformation driven by technological innovation, shifting regulatory landscapes, and sustainability imperatives. Advancements in digital integration have introduced IoT connectivity and smart diagnostics into filter dryer platforms, enabling predictive maintenance and real-time performance monitoring. Concurrently, energy efficiency mandates have spurred the development of low-power consumption designs, reducing operational costs and carbon footprints. Manufacturers now leverage novel materials such as advanced polymer composites and hydrophobic coatings to enhance moisture removal efficiency and extend filter lifespans. Sustainability focus has accelerated adoption of eco-friendly refrigerants and heat recovery systems within refrigerated dryer technologies. Alongside these technical evolutions, supply chain resilience has emerged as a strategic priority, leading firms to localize critical components and diversify supplier networks. As a result, the competitive landscape is shifting from solely product-centric innovation to integrated service offerings, smart servicing contracts, and digital lifecycle management. These transformative shifts underscore the growing role of filter dryer equipment as an enabler of both operational excellence and environmental stewardship.
Cumulative Impact of United States Tariffs 2025
Beginning in early 2025, enhanced tariffs on imported filter dryer components and finished units have exerted a measurable influence on cost structures and procurement strategies in the United States. Raw material surcharges now account for a higher proportion of total device costs, prompting end-users to reevaluate supplier agreements and explore domestic manufacturing options. Inventory management practices have adjusted accordingly, with many distributors broadening their safety stock cushions to mitigate lead time variability driven by customs processing. Some original equipment manufacturers have invested in regional assembly hubs to sidestep punitive duties, while aftermarket service providers face margin pressure as replacement element prices climb. The cumulative impact has elevated the strategic importance of total cost of ownership analyses, compelling maintenance contractors and facility managers to adopt lifecycle-based purchasing models. Furthermore, heightened import tariffs have spurred increased collaboration between North American firms and technology licensors overseas, ensuring continued access to cutting-edge drying solutions without full tariff exposure. In this environment, procurement teams prioritize suppliers with localized production footprints or tariff-avoidance strategies, balancing immediate price pressures against long-term reliability and service assurance.

Key Regional Insights
Regional dynamics reveal notable variations in adoption rates, regulatory compliance standards, and technology preferences. In the Americas, North American manufacturers emphasize energy-efficient refrigerated dryers and heatless desiccant systems to meet stringent environmental regulations and rising energy costs, while Latin American producers favor simpler, low-maintenance designs due to infrastructure constraints. Europe, the Middle East & Africa exhibits strong demand for advanced digital integration, with EU directives accelerating the shift toward IoT-enabled monitoring and diagnostic capabilities; meanwhile, Middle Eastern petrochemical hubs invest heavily in high-capacity rotary valve technologies, and select African markets prioritize affordable, ruggedized configurations. Asia-Pacific leads volume growth, driven by rapid industrialization in China and Southeast Asia; here, local equipment manufacturers adopt mixed portfolios that blend cost-effective value units with premium imported systems. Government incentives in Japan and South Korea further stimulate research into next-generation centrifugal dryers and hybrid systems that combine refrigeration and desiccant elements. Across all regions, the acceleration of greenfield industrial projects and modernization of legacy plants continue to shape geographic demand patterns and service ecosystems.
